Fermenters

Brewery fermenters play fundamental roles in the beverage and processing industries. Fermenters are vessels where the primary fermentation process takes place. This is the stage in brewing where yeast converts sugars from the malt into alcohol and carbon dioxide, resulting in beer. These vessels are often cylindrical-conical in shape and allow brewers to control fermentation parameters such as temperature.
